[局所的に進行した遠隔胃がんのための腹腔鏡手術におけるNo.12aリンパ節解剖の合理的な程度]

まとめ
進行胃がんにおけるNo.12aリンパ節の解剖は,No.12a2グループでは低転移を示している. さらなる研究が必要ですが,解剖は,進行した疾患またはNo.12a1転移の特定の患者に利益をもたらす可能性があります.

背景:
- 局所的に進行した遠部胃がんには,正確な手術段階が求められます.
- リンパ節解剖の程度,特にNo.12a節の場合は,治療決定に影響を与えます.
- 胃がんの手術におけるリンパ切除術の最適化は,正確なステージと予後のために不可欠です.
研究 の 目的:
- 局所的に進行した遠隔胃がんにおけるNo.12aリンパ節解剖の転移率と臨床的重要性を評価する.
- ラパロスコピカル・ラディカル・ディスタル・ガストレクトミーにおけるNo.12aリンパ節解剖の適切な程度を決定する.
- No.12aリンパ節転移に関連する臨床病理学的要因を特定する.
主な方法:
- D2リンパドネクトミーによる腹腔鏡による遠隔胃切除術を受けた局所的に進行した遠隔胃がん患者191人を対象とした見通し観察研究.
- リンパ節ステーションNo.12a1とNo.12a2の病理学的検査を別々に行う.
- 転移率の分析,臨床病理学的特徴との相関,および多変量分析.
主要な成果:
- 全体的にNo.12aリンパ節転移率は7.9%で,No.12a1は6.8%,No.12a2は3.7%であった.
- No.12a2 リンパ節転移はpN3ステージと病理的ステージIIIと相関する.
- No.12a1リンパ節転移はNo.12a2リンパ節転移の独立したリスク因子でした.
結論:
- No.12a2 リンパ節転移は,局所的に進行した遠隔胃がんではまれであり,その解剖は,通常の臨床価値が限られている可能性があることを示唆しています.
- No.12a2リンパ節の解剖は,臨床段階のcN3またはステージIIIの患者,または手術中のNo.12a1転移の患者にとって有益である可能性があります.
- 胃がん管理におけるNo.12a2リンパ節解剖の正確な役割を明らかにするために,さらなる調査が必要である.

Detailed Structure and Function of Lymph Nodes
5.1K
Lymph nodes are bean-shaped structures that cluster along the lymphatic vessels in the inguinal, axillary, and cervical regions. Each node is divided into compartments by a capsule that extends trabeculae inward.
From a histological perspective, lymph nodes can be split into two main areas: the superficial cortex and the deep medulla. The outer cortex is populated by dendritic cells, macrophages, and B lymphocytes, which are densely packed into follicles. When these B-lymphocytes are presented...

Reason and Intuition
7.5K
The human brain processes information for decision-making using one of two routes: an intuitive system and a rational system (Epstein, 1994; popularized by Kahneman, 2011 as System 1 and System 2, respectively). The intuitive system is quick, impulsive, and operates with minimal effort, relying on emotions or habits to provide cues for what to do next, while the rational system is logical, analytical, deliberate, and methodical. Deductive Reasoning
69.4K
Deductive reasoning, or deduction, is the type of logic used in hypothesis-based science. In deductive reasoning, the pattern of thinking moves in the opposite direction as compared to inductive reasoning, which means that it uses a general principle or law to predict specific results. From those general principles, a scientist can deduce and predict the specific results that would be valid as long as the general principles are valid.

Inductive Reasoning
68.1K
Inductive reasoning is a form of logical thinking that uses related observations to arrive at a general conclusion. It is uncertain and operates in degrees to which the conclusions are credible. As such, inductive arguments can be weak or strong, rather than valid or invalid, and conclusions can be used to formulate testable, falsifiable hypotheses.

Gastric Motility
3.3K
Gastric motility is the coordinated contraction and relaxation of stomach muscles that convert ingested food into chyme, a semi-liquid substance ready for further digestion in the intestines. The process begins with the vagus nerve inducing the relaxation of the smooth muscles in the fundus and body of the stomach, allowing these regions to expand and accommodate up to approximately 1.5 liters of food and liquid.
